Sala Consilina, last night the “Cicerone dresses chic” fashion show

An evening event that celebrated the commitment, study and creativity of the students of the Itis Sistema Moda specialization of the “Marco Tullio Cicerone” Institute in Sala Consilina. Yesterday evening, at the “Mario Scarpetta” Municipal Theater, the Institute’s end-of-year fashion show called “Cicerone dresses chic” was held. The girls of the IIIC, IVC and VC classes, with the help of the specialization teachers, Professor Alessandra Guida, professor of Fashion and design and the teacher Mariachiara Volpe Del Franco, technician of Fashion and design, presented three wonderful steps of the fashion show dedicated to cocktail dresses, evening dresses and formal dresses.

The fashion show was presented by the institute representative and student of the VC class, Michela De Luca and by Jacopo Petrizzo, while the students Diana Lovaglio and Anna Carmen Manzo took care of the lights and sound. Among the guests Oriana Parrella of Stregatta Fashion, known for basing her brand on the concepts of sustainability, inclusiveness and solidarity and lei, presented by prof. Morena, the stylist Antonio Martino, who, unable to be present in person at the evening, sent a video with all the masterpieces he created. Furthermore, the large audience present was able to attend a special performance of the Educational Dance Laboratory, conducted by the teacher Antonella Morena, an initiative that involved students for the entire school year during the afternoon hours. On stage is a show of Rueda Salsa, a Caribbean dance created with maestro Vincenzo D’Elia, President of the Santa Barbara Association of Teggiano. Finally, the singing performance by Emilio Petrosino of 3D Itis was also highly appreciated.

The evening ended with greetings from the Mayor Francesco Cavallone and speeches from the vice principal Michelina Gasaro and the principal Antonella Vairo. “A beautiful and participatory moment – ​​stated the school director Vairo –, in which the girls were able to show what they do at school, and their talents, but they also put themselves on the line. Fashion is a very interesting field because it allows those who have this passion to cultivate it and be able to undertake various paths in the world of work, to collaborate with other stylists or even to continue their university studies by graduating in the teaching of specialized subjects. Alongside the girls we also had adult students from the evening course who created very meaningful clothes, with a call to peace. Many accessories were also made. It was truly an emotional moment.”
